Wall Street Zen cut shares of WesBanco (NASDAQ:WSBC – Free Report) from a buy rating to a hold rating in a report issued on Friday.
WesBanco Trading Up 0.7%
Shares of WSBC stock opened at $32.33 on Friday. WesBanco has a 12-month low of $26.42 and a 12-month high of $37.36. The company has a market capitalization of $3.10 billion, a PE ratio of 19.48 and a beta of 0.85. The firm has a 50 day moving average price of $31.60 and a two-hundred day moving average price of $31.08. The company has a quick ratio of 0.93, a current ratio of 0.94 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.57.
WesBanco (NASDAQ:WSBC – Get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Tuesday, July 29th. The financial services provider reported $0.91 earnings per share for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.87 by $0.04. WesBanco had a return on equity of 7.29% and a net margin of 11.65%.The company had revenue of $260.73 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$261.14 million. During the same quarter last year, the company earned $0.49 earnings per share. As a group, analysts predict that WesBanco will post 3.24 earnings per share for the current year.

About WesBanco
WesBanco, Inc operates as the bank holding company for WesBanco Bank, Inc that provides retail banking, corporate banking, personal and corporate trust, brokerage, mortgage banking, and insurance services to individuals and businesses in the United States. The company operates through two segments, Community Banking, and Trust and Investment Services.
